helpful-decorators使用手册

helpful-decorators使用手册

helpful-decorators Helpful decorators for typescript projects helpful-decorators 项目地址: https://gitcode.com/gh_mirrors/he/helpful-decorators


1. 项目目录结构及介绍

helpful-decorators 是一个专为 TypeScript 设计的装饰器集合,致力于简化编码过程并提升代码效率。以下是该项目的基本目录结构概述:

.
├── __tests__         # 单元测试文件夹
│   ├── ...
├── src               # 核心源码
│   ├── ...
├── gitignore         # Git忽略文件配置
├── npmignore         # NPM发布时的忽略文件列表
├── travis.yml        # Travis CI 的配置文件
├── ISSUE_TEMPLATE.md # 问题提交模板
├── LICENSE           # 开源许可文件,MIT License
├── README.md         # 项目说明文档
├── package.json      # 包含项目依赖和脚本命令的文件
├── package-lock.json # 详细锁定版本的依赖文件
└── yarn.lock         # Yarn使用的依赖版本锁定文件
  • __tests__: 包含所有用于单元测试的案例。
  • src: 存放主要的装饰器实现代码。
  • gitignorenpmignore: 分别指导Git和NPM忽略不需要提交或发布的文件。
  • travis.yml: 用于自动化持续集成的配置。
  • ISSUE_TEMPLATE.md: 提供了一种标准化的方式提交问题。
  • LICENSE: 明确了项目的授权方式(MIT)。
  • README.md: 项目的核心说明文档,包括安装和基本用法。
  • package.json, package-lock.json, yarn.lock: 有关项目依赖管理和版本控制。

2. 项目的启动文件介绍

此项目本身并不直接提供一个"启动文件",因为它是一组装饰器库而非可运行的应用程序。开发者使用时,通过导入所需的装饰器到他们的TypeScript项目中来“启动”对这些功能的利用。例如,在自己的项目中添加以下导入语句来使用装饰器:

import { delay, debounce, throttle, once, measure } from 'helpful-decorators';

随后在类定义或函数上应用这些装饰器即可。

3. 项目的配置文件介绍

package.json

该文件是项目的核心配置文件,包含了项目的元数据、脚本命令、依赖项等。例如,开发者可以通过运行npm或yarn命令执行指定的脚本来编译、测试或部署项目。示例中的关键字段可能包括:

  • scripts: 定义了执行特定任务的命令,如 "test": "jest",用于运行测试。
  • dependenciesdevDependencies: 列出了项目运行或开发过程中所需的所有外部包。

.travis.yml

在CI/CD流程中至关重要,它指示Travis CI如何构建、测试项目。示例配置可以包含环境设置、部署触发条件、测试指令等。

由于直接阅读原始的.gitignore, .npmignore, 和其他配置文件可以获得更详细的配置信息,建议开发者参考项目仓库中的实际文件以获取最具体的信息。

以上就是helpful-decorators项目的主要目录结构、启动方法概念和配置文件简介。开发者在集成这些装饰器到他们的TypeScript项目之前,应当详细查阅项目的README.md文件,以获得安装、配置和使用这些装饰器的具体步骤。

helpful-decorators Helpful decorators for typescript projects helpful-decorators 项目地址: https://gitcode.com/gh_mirrors/he/helpful-decorators

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

贡锨庆

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值